A serves as storage layer for historical data of XFI chain and provides meaningful business insights, embeddable charts and data API. It is designed to store large volumes of historical data and enable fast, complex queries across various data types.

Key Features:

  • Analysis: Optimized for read access, making it efficient for analytical queries which help in reporting, data mining, and predictive analytics.

  • Historical Intelligence: Maintains historical data to analyze trends over time, providing a valuable resource for longitudinal studies and forecasting.

  • Scalability: Designed to scale out to handle terabytes to petabytes of data, accommodating growth seamlessly.

  • Performance: Built with performance optimization mechanisms such as indexing, partitioning, and caching to ensure quick retrieval of data.

Technologies Involved:

The backbone technologies of Data Warehouses include Clickhouse and Redash query and execution engine.

Data Warehouse is a builder's tool that aggregates all data in one place, simplifies complex data analysis, and supports high-speed querying and reporting, all of which empower applications build process.
